If a Duck Quacks in the Forest and Everyone Hears, Should You Care?
Description
YES! "Duck posting" has become an internet meme for praising DuckDB on Twitter. Nearly every quack using DuckDB has done it once or twice. But, why all the fuss? With advances in CPUs, memory, SSDs, and the software that enables it all, our personal machines are powerful beasts relegated to handling a few Chrome tabs and sitting 90% idle. As data engineers and data analysts, this seems like a waste that's not only expensive, but also impacting the environment. In this session, you will see how DuckDB brings SQL analytics capabilities to a 2MB standalone executable on your laptop that only recently required a large cluster. This session will explain the architecture of DuckDB that enables high performance analytics on a laptop: great query optimization, vectorized execution, continuous improvements in compression and more. We will show its capabilities using live demos, from the pandas library to WASM, to the command-line. We'll demonstrate performance on large datasets, and talk about how we're exploring using the laptop to augment cloud analytics workloads.
